Sadness is easy

Sadness is easy. Sadness is fluid. Sadness is a teardrop that flows to a river Sadness flows. Sadness is the rain that pours on a Sunday afternoon Sadness pours. Sadness is a long drive in a strech of a road without trees without people without houses Sadness stretches Sadness is never ending. Sadness is looking outside the airplane window seeing nothing but clouds no ground no greens no blues. Sadness is looking up at the sky at the vast dark sky without stars without clouds without the moon. Sadness is the abyss Sadness is blank Sadness is flat Sadness is stagnant Sadness is easy.
